What Are the Benefits of Joint Replacement Surgery for Severe Joint Damage?

Joint replacement surgery is a significant medical procedure performed to alleviate pain and restore function in severely damaged joints. This type of surgery has been a game-changer for many individuals suffering from chronic joint conditions such as osteoarth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, and other degenerative joint diseases. Here, we will explore the numerous benefits of joint replacement surgery for those facing severe joint damage.

1. Pain Relief:
One of the most immediate and noticeable benefits of joint replacement surgery is substantial pain relief. Many patients experience debilitating pain that limits their daily activities. Joint replacement surgery can significantly reduce or eliminate this pain, allowing individuals to return to a more active lifestyle.

2. Improved Mobility:
Severe joint damage often leads to restricted movement and stiffness. After joint replacement surgery, patients frequently report improved mobility, which allows them to engage in activities they once enjoyed. Enhanced flexibility and range of motion are often achieved, helping individuals regain independence in their daily routines.

3. Enhanced Quality of Life:
The restoration of mobility and the reduction of pain have a positive impact on overall quality of life. Patients often find that they can engage in social activities, exercise, and hobbies they had to give up, leading to improved mental well-being and happiness.

4. Long-lasting Results:
Joint replacement surgeries, particularly in hip and knee joints, have shown to provide long-lasting results. Modern prosthetic joints are designed to withstand years of use and can significantly extend the functional life of the joint. Many patients enjoy years of pain-free activity after a successful surgery.

5. Minimally Invasive Techniques:
Advancements in medical technology have led to the development of minimally invasive joint replacement techniques. These methods result in smaller incisions, reduced blood loss, and quicker recovery times. Patients often experience less postoperative pain and a shorter hospital stay compared to traditional surgery.

6. Personalized Treatment Plans:
Every patient’s situation is unique, and orthopedic surgeons tailor joint replacement procedures to meet individual needs. This personalized approach ensures the best outcomes and addresses specific concerns such as age, activity level, and overall health status.

7. Access to Rehabilitation:
Following joint replacement surgery, patients typically embark on a structured rehabilitation program designed to maximize their recovery. This program is crucial for restoring strength and function, enabling patients to return to their daily lives more effectively.

8. Psychological Benefits:
Dealing with chronic joint pain can take a toll on mental health. Successful joint replacement surgery can lead to improved self-esteem, reduced anxiety related to physical limitations, and an overall enhancement of mental health. Patients often feel more positive and empowered to engage in life after the surgery.
